Break-glass access: Fenwright serverless handlers. Plugin authors occasionally need break-glass access when cold starts exceed the 30-second gateway timeout and handlers appear dead. Before invoking break-glass, confirm it's a genuine cold-start stall: check the warm-pool metrics and retry once. Break-glass bypasses the warm pool and attaches directly to the runtime, so use it sparingly and log the reason. To open the break-glass console, enter the recovery passphrase shown below.

recovery phrase for kahof-tahag: istox-eliael-istath

16:03 — Ledgerpane diff viewer began OOM-killing on files over 400 MB after the chunked-render flag was accidentally disabled in the Quarrel release train. Users saw blank panes; error rate hit 18%. 16:19 — Rollback blocked by a migration lock. 16:34 — Flag re-enabled via config push, memory stabilized, error rate back under 1% by 16:41. Root cause: flag default flipped during config refactor. The faulty artifact is identified by the token below.

session token of tajef-bageg = htk21_5d90d574934f3ccae6437

Hello Ardenline integration team,

Ahead of next week's review, a few notes on the Vellum PDF invoice renderer. All rendering runs in a sandboxed worker with no outbound network access; embedded fonts are re-encoded, and JavaScript actions are stripped at parse time. Template inputs are validated against a strict schema before layout begins. For your penetration testing, we have provisioned an isolated tenant with synthetic invoice data; authenticate your test harness using the token that follows.

login token, yadug-bahif: eyJhbGciOiJIUzI1NiIsInR5cCI6IkpXVCJ9.eyJzdWIiOiIQtoBQDuynwIn0.ypA80I7M5js8